Gastonia, North Carolina, nestled just west of Charlotte, boasts a vibrant community characterized by friendly neighborhoods and a strong local economy. As the largest city in Gaston County, it offers diverse cultural experiences and access to a variety of amenities. However, the city faces social and economic challenges, including fluctuations in employment and housing affordability, which can significantly impact residents' mental health. Many individuals may grapple with stress, anxiety, or depression stemming from economic uncertainty or social isolation. Fortunately, Gastonia is home to an array of mental health resources, including community centers and professional services that provide counseling and support for various mental health issues. These resources cater to different demographics, ensuring that everyone can find the help they need.
